This game scares me a bit.
The Cowboys were one of the most explosive offensive teams in the league up until Dak Prescott went down. They have firepower with Cooper, Lamb, Gallup Schultz and Zeke. And with Andy Dalton returning this week, they at least won't be inept at quarterback. Zeke has had a poor year, which could mean he's due for a breakout game. I hope it's not this week.
Their defense is pretty bad, no doubt. But they played well against Pittsburgh, and they're coming off their bye.
The Vikings need to keep doing what they've been doing — solid O-line play, establish the run to set up the pass, and play good enough defense to at least take away something from the opponent and make them one-dimensional. But special teams HAVE to improve, period. You can't keep having bad snaps, long returns, blocked punts and penalties. Our once-solid special teams unit has suddenly looked inept to the point that we hold our breath on every play. Marwaan Malouf must fix this, and fix it yesterday.
I think the Vikings will win the game. But I fear it will be closer than any of us want, and when the other team is close, the Vikings are good at breaking our hearts. Need to continue our first-quarter dominance, and we should be fine. These next three games are absolute must-wins. After that, it's road games at Tampa and New Orleans. If we want to sniff the playoffs, we have to take these next three. It starts with Dallas on Sunday.

I think Dalvin Cook is going to rip the Dallas defense a new one this Sunday.
I don't know if that means the Vikings win the game because the Vikings still have to stop the Dallas offense, but when the Vikings have the ball I think they're going to feed Cook and Cook is going to deliver in a memorable way. He's frustrated after that Bears game. The OL is frustrated too. They're going to take it out on a poor run defense on Sunday. I see Cook ripping off some big gainers and punching it in multiple times.
The three things I'm looking for against the Cowboys will be:
- Defensive secondary play by the Vikings. I'm patiently waiting for these secondary guys to start making some anticipatory plays on the ball and get a few picks. Specifically, the CBs.
- Along those lines I want to see the defensive front 7 continue to limit rushing yards by the Cowboys on early downs. Andy Dalton is a solid QB, but if the Vikings can force the Cowboys into longer 3rd down situations and come after him with mixed pressures, I like their chances to get the Cowboys off the field. The Vikings were good at this during their 3 game win streak, and in my opinion they'll have to continue to be good at it to make it a 4 game win streak.
- Lastly, I want to see the special teams pull it's weight. No more dumb mistakes. No more big returns by the opposing team.
I like the Vikings chances in this one. Records of the two teams has little to do with that. The Cowboys just don't match up well against the strength of the Vikings offense, and defensively I think the Vikings can limit what the Cowboys will want to do.
